Description
"Those Summer Days" is a slice-of-life manga that centers around a group of teenagers navigating the complexities of adolescence during a pivotal summer. The story unfolds in a small coastal town, where the protagonist, a reserved high school student named Haruto, returns after several years away. Haruto reconnects with his childhood friends, including the spirited and outgoing Aoi, the thoughtful and artistic Riku, and the quiet yet observant Sora. Together, they spend their days exploring the town, revisiting old haunts, and confronting unresolved emotions from their past.

The narrative delves into themes of friendship, self-discovery, and the passage of time. Haruto struggles with feelings of guilt over leaving his friends behind, while Aoi grapples with her own insecurities about the future. Riku, who harbors unspoken feelings for Aoi, finds himself caught between loyalty to his friends and his personal desires. Sora, often the voice of reason, provides a grounding presence as the group navigates their shared and individual challenges.

As the summer progresses, the characters confront pivotal moments that force them to reevaluate their relationships and aspirations. A long-forgotten promise made during their childhood resurfaces, becoming a central point of tension. The group embarks on a journey to fulfill this promise, leading to moments of introspection and emotional revelation. The manga balances lighthearted, nostalgic scenes with poignant moments of growth, capturing the bittersweet nature of adolescence and the fleeting beauty of summer.

The coastal setting plays a significant role in the story, with its serene beaches, vibrant festivals, and quiet sunsets serving as a backdrop for the characters' experiences. The manga's pacing allows for a gradual exploration of each character's inner world, revealing their fears, dreams, and vulnerabilities. Through their interactions, the story emphasizes the importance of communication, forgiveness, and cherishing the present.

"Those Summer Days" concludes with a sense of closure, as the characters come to terms with their past and embrace the uncertainties of the future. The final chapters highlight the enduring strength of their bond, leaving readers with a heartfelt reflection on the transformative power of friendship and the memories that define a summer.
